Can you use other rice?
It’s best to use wild rice in this recipe. White rice has a quicker cooking time so will be over cooked and mushy if you use it. You can substitute with brown rice at a pinch which has a longer cooking time.
Can you make it ahead of time?
Leftovers will keep in the fridge for up to 4 days and can be reheated on the stovetop. The rice will absorb a lot of the liquid, so when you reheat it you can stir in some milk, water or stock so that it loosens up.
Can you make this with other cuts of chicken?
I prefer to make this with chicken breast as it shreds easily, but you can use chicken thighs if that’s what you have. You can also use pre-cooked chicken like rotisserie and shred that, just add it in at the end of cooking when you add the cream.
Recipe Notes and Tips
- It’s best not to freeze this soup as the rice will change in texture.
- Taste the soup before serving and adjust the seasoning if needed.
- If storing, let it cool to room temperature first.
- Feel free to add in different veggies that you have in your fridge.
Instant Pot Chicken Wild Rice Soup

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 1 onion diced (about 1 cup)
- 1 bell pepper any color; diced (about 1 cup)
- 2 carrots peeled and sliced (about 1½ cups)
- 1 cup mushrooms sliced or chopped
- 1 cup dry wild rice blend
- 2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1 pound)
- 1 teaspoon blackened seasoning
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 2 bay leaves
- ½ teaspoon kosher salt plus more to taste
- 1 teaspoon ground black pepper
- 4 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- ¾ cup heavy whipping cream
- Fresh parsley optional, for garnish
Instructions
- Place the oil, onion, bell pepper, and carrots into an instant pot and press the “saute” button. Saute vegetables until tender, about 5 minutes.1 tablespoon vegetable oil, 1 onion, 1 bell pepper, 2 carrots
- Add in the mushrooms and continue cooking until mushrooms have released their juices, about 1-2 minutes.1 cup mushrooms
- Stir in the rice and press “cancel” to turn off saute mode.1 cup dry wild rice blend
- Layer on the chicken breast, blackened seasoning, garlic powder, bay leaves, salt, black pepper, and chicken broth.2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ts, 1 teaspoon blackened seasoning, 1 teaspoon garlic powder, 2 bay leaves, ½ teaspoon kosher salt, 1 teaspoon ground black pepper, 4 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- Put on the lid of the instant pot and turn on manual pressure. Make sure the valve is turned to the sealing position. Set the timer for 25 minutes. Once the timer goes off, allow the soup to naturally release for 10 minutes before using the quick release.
- Take chicken out of soup and shred.
- Add in shredded chicken and heavy cream and stir.¾ cup heavy whipping cream
- Serve up soup and garnish with chopped parsley, optional.Fresh parsley
